To iterate, sub-platforms are about *platforms*, identified by PCI IDs, and they are *not* about features. If you want to add a macro about a *feature*, for convenience, or for the purpose of self-documenting code, you add a HAS_FEATURE() macro. For example: #define HAS_480_MHZ_CDCLK(__i915) IS_ADLP_RPLU(__i915) Later on, you can add more platforms to that feature macro if needed. And if there turns out to be *other* features that are specific to RPL-U, you don't have to check for them using a macro that refers to a specific CDCLK frequency. In summary, this is a resounding no to IS_ADLP_WITH_480CDCLK() and INTEL_SUBPLATFORM_480CDCLK.
